I've tried to try them... they either require windows (or osx) or don't
appear to plug into firefox.

Cortona: windows only.

CosmoPlayer: windows or powermac only.

FreeWRL: might work with plenty of hacking. I'll keep this in mind as a
last resort.

OpenVRML: again, plenty of hacking required.


I didn't mention I'm running debian stable...

I did find that cortona works very nicely... in windows XP with firefox
so its not a lot of use to me at work.
